Structural engineer services involve assessing the stability, safety, and integrity of various types of structures. These professionals analyze building plans, inspect existing constructions, and provide detailed reports on potential issues related to load-bearing elements, foundation stability, and overall design. Their evaluations help identify structural weaknesses or risks that could compromise safety or lead to costly repairs if left unaddressed. By conducting thorough assessments, they help property owners and developers ensure that buildings meet safety standards and are capable of supporting the intended use.

These services are essential for solving problems related to structural damage, deterioration, or design flaws. Common issues include foundation settling, cracks in walls, sagging floors, or signs of structural fatigue. Structural engineers can determine the causes of these problems and recommend appropriate solutions, whether it involves repairs, reinforcements, or modifications to the existing framework. Their expertise is also valuable during renovations or expansions, ensuring that new additions integrate safely with existing structures without overloading or destabilizing the property.

Properties that typically utilize structural engineering services include residential homes, commercial buildings, and industrial facilities. For residential properties, these services are often sought when there are signs of structural distress or during major renovations, such as additions or basement excavations. Commercial and industrial properties may require assessments before construction projects, after natural events like storms or earthquakes, or when planning upgrades that impact the building’s load capacity. Regardless of property type, structural engineers help safeguard the longevity and safety of structures in various settings.

The overview below groups typical Structural Engineer Service proj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Washtenaw County, MI.

In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.

Consultation Fees - Structural engineering consultations typically range from $100 to $300 per hour, depending on project complexity. For example, a basic assessment might cost around $150, while more detailed evaluations could reach $250 or more.

Structural Analysis Costs - Comprehensive structural analysis services generally fall between $1,000 and $3,000 for residential projects. Larger or more complex structures may incur costs exceeding $5,000, depending on scope and size.

Design and Plan Services - Designing structural plans usually costs between $2,000 and $6,000 for standard residential buildings. Custom or large-scale projects can have fees that surpass $10,000, based on design complexity.

Inspection and Report Expenses - Structural inspection reports typically range from $300 to $800, with detailed evaluations for larger structures potentially costing more. Costs vary based on the extent of inspection required and property size.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

Structural engineer services are often sought by property owners in Washtenaw County, MI, when planning significant renovations or additions. For example, if a homeowner wants to remove a load-bearing wall or add a new extension to their house, a structural engineer can evaluate the existing framework and provide plans to ensure safety and stability. These professionals are also consulted when dealing with foundation concerns or detecting structural issues that may compromise a building’s integrity, helping property owners address problems before they worsen.

In other cases, property owners might look for structural engineer services during the process of purchasing or refinancing a property. A thorough assessment can reveal underlying structural problems that could affect the property's value or safety. Additionally, when building new structures or garages, structural engineers can assist in designing foundations and frameworks that meet local building standards.
